Like others mentioned, Leon Rausch was a class act. I had the opportunity to play Steel Guitar backing him on some shows at The Grapevine Opry of Texas and at their Branson Missouri Starlite Theater during the early 1980s. He was really a great guy, wonderful singer and entertainer. We had a lot of fun and laughs. Leon Rausch was born near Billings, Missouri about 40 miles from where I live. As a person drives thru that small country town,they have a sign by the highway that honors him as a member of Bob Wills and his Texas Playboys Band.
